Laser Engraver G-Code from SVG

Diode lasers (xTool, Sculpfun, Ortur, NEJE) and CO₂ lasers (K40, OMTech, Thunder) all use G-Code for vector engraving and cutting. This generator creates firmware-specific G-Code from your SVG that can be sent directly to your laser via USB or WiFi using LaserGRBL, LightBurn, or the machine's native software.

Can I use this for a Sculpfun or xTool laser?
Yes. Sculpfun and xTool lasers both use GRBL firmware and accept standard GRBL laser G-Code.
